Is SRECTrade charging me a commission?

0

SRECTrade has a two-tier service. The auction transaction represents the first tier. Buyers pay the greater of a 3% transaction fee for any SRECs or $5 per SREC purchased in auction. Sellers in the auction do not pay any fees and will recieve the clearing price in the auction. If the clearing price is $100, sellers get $100, buyers pay $100 + $5 to SRECTrade. If the clearing price is $300, sellers get $300 and buyers pay $300 + $9 to SRECTrade. In addition to the auction platform, SRECTrade offers an optional premium service for sellers called EasyREC, this represents the second tier of our service. Sellers who sign up for EasyREC will be charged a service fee for the SRECs they sell through EasyREC. For all states except New Jersey, the fee is the greater of $5 or 5% of the sale price per SREC.
